Transaction 770953fc3da28eae0b5b985f98c790b8c4e1cab4f9cec6085c00798956389773

1 Input
2 Outputs
  • 770953fc3da28eae0b5b985f98c790b8c4e1cab4f9cec6085c00798956389773:0
  • value  245032
    address  14ovBcKTvTEkSxJGpAXjVe3x5FePyPA5rV
  • 770953fc3da28eae0b5b985f98c790b8c4e1cab4f9cec6085c00798956389773:1
  • value  937113007
    address  1MzPjRFeG7ArnpFcHuwDDGu8P95EYMUoDZ